Black History Month Celebration

Boone Hall Plantation is excited to announce that the African American Settlement Community Historic Commission has put together a groundbreaking Black History Month celebration that will be presented for the first time and showcased in the newly renovated Gin House throughout the month of February.

The exciting lineup includes celebration displays by churches, schools, military, community organizations, descendant achievements and accomplishments, a Weekend Speaker Series that will feature seven high profile guest speakers, Settlement Community Panel Discussions, A Taste Of Gullah Mount Pleasant style, and other features.

Black History Month events are included with regular admission to Boone Hall Plantation at no additional charge. A portion of the proceeds will benefit the 1904 Long Point School restoration project.
